For a tattoo to be long-term, the ink-drenched needle has to get to cells in the dermis layer. Cells in the epidermis undertake turnover as older cells are lost and are replaced by brand-new ones. Any type of ink held in this layer will certainly also be lost. Cells in the dermis are not shed, hence the injected ink stays in location.
So, by the time all the cells in that location pass away and hand over (which can take up to a couple of months in grownups), the tattoo fades. Currently for the flaw. Many people (specifically if you're doing a do it yourself stick-and-poke) have no concept where the epidermis ends, and the dermis starts.

One more prominent type of temporary tattoo is the water transfer tattoo. These tattoos are used a slim sheet of paper with the tattoo style printed on one side and a layer of water-soluble adhesive on the various other. To use a water transfer tattoo, you first place the paper with the style against the skin.
As the water enters into contact with the sticky, it liquifies the momentary bond holding the tattoo layout, enabling the ink to transfer to the skin. Many momentary tattoos utilize ink that is particularly created to be quickly used and gotten rid of without creating any damage to the skin. The ink utilized in momentary tattoos is normally made from a mix of FDA-approved colorants and other safe ingredients. These colorants are made to rest on the surface of the skin and develop vibrant styles without discoloration or penetrating the skin.
